1. display:block 1.1 block元素会独占一行,多个block元素会各自新起一行。默认情况下,block元素的宽度会自动填满其父元素宽度。 1.2 block元素可以设置其width,height属性。块级元素即使设置了宽度,仍然是独占一行,但如果有margin且block元素本身的宽度不足父元素宽度的100%的话,该元素宽度+margin才是100%。 1.3 blo...
并不是所有浏览器都支持此属性,目前支持的浏览器有:Opera、Safari在IE中对内联元素使用display:inline-block,IE是不识别的,但使用display:inline-block在IE下会触发layout,从而使内联元素拥有了display:inline-block属性的表症。从上面的这个分析,也不难理解为什么IE下,对块元素设置display:inline-block属性无法实现inlin...
总之,display:block属性是CSS中一种重要的布局控制手段。它使得原本可能作为行内元素的文本或链接,可以被调整为具有独立行显示、可设置尺寸和样式的块级元素,极大地丰富了网页设计的布局和交互方式。掌握这一属性,对于实现更加精细、动态的网页布局具有重要意义。
HTML中display属性决定元素的显示方式,"block"与"inline"是两个重要属性。当使用display:block时,元素会变为块级元素,自动换行并占据整行宽度。代码示例:a.ib{ display:block; }。原本a标签作为行级元素,加上display:block属性后即变为块级元素,能独立占据一行。然而,若a标签外包裹的是行级元素...
与display:inline相对应的是display:block。block会让应用了该CSS属性的HTML标记变成块级元素,例如原本的是行内显示的,但加上display:block属性后会变为块级元素,如和会分别占据一行。display:inline最经典的用法是用于标签中。block通常一个块级元素占据一行,除非设置了浮动属性,否则inline元素会自动排...
3、display:none 4、总结 1、block 块级元素 1.1、块级元素特点 a. block元素会独占一行,多个block元素会各自新起一行。默认情况下,block元素宽度自动填满其父级宽度。 b. block元素可以设置width,height属性。块级元素即使设置了宽度,仍然是独占一行。
1、display:inline:用在 下的 中 内联 block一般一个块占一行,除非float inline是自动排为一行,就象段内的文字一样,可成为多行。2、display:block:block 会让应用了该 CSS 属性的 HTML 标记变成块级别元素,例如 SPAN 是行内显示的,但是加了 display:block 属性就不同。 SPAN1 。参考资料...
display:block;比较常用于这两个标签——因为这两个标签非块元素,如果不用display:block定义一下,那么定义width、height等和长宽相关的css属性时会发现完全不生效。通常情况下div里就没有必要写display:block;特殊情况:之前曾对div设置过display:hidden;需要写display:block; 上述内容就是如何在css中使用display:block;...
display: block 属性影响flex布局 display: block属性可防止justify-content产生影响。 不妨尝试将display设为除block之外的某个值。 align-content也是用于flex布局的,但是 所谓的对于单行的弹性盒模型无效,指的是该弹性盒模型使用了flex-wrap:nowrap属性。 这句话的意思很简单:就是,align-content生效与否取决于flex-...
百度试题 题目CSS属性中,display:block; 表示将元素显示为() 相关知识点: 试题来源: 解析 块级元素 反馈 收藏